Thats still all capitalism. There is no socialism in capitalism even when the wealthy make huge wealth transfers.
Why is it so hard to understand that all socialism is is when workers control the means of production just like capitalists do in capitalism.
If they control the means then it is capitalism, if we(the workers) control it then that's socialism.
Transferring wealth is just that, wealth transfer.
Having the national purse pay for bailouts is not socialism.
This idea of getting something for nothing is not socialism.
You're absolutely right but everything that sides with labor over capital is considered socialism in the US. Banning child labor, two day weekend, Medicare/Medicaid, social security... These were all labelled socialist policies at one point or another.
